🙌 About the Role

The Advancement Coordinator plays a key support role on The WOW Center’s Advancement team, helping to build meaningful relationships with donors, support fundraising campaigns, coordinate events, promote The WOW Center through marketing and communications, supports advancement operations by maintaining donor tracking systems, monitoring pipeline activity, and assisting with reporting on fundraising progress . This position is ideal for a detail-oriented, creative, and relationship-driven individual who is passionate about our mission and eager to grow within the nonprofit sector.

🌱 What You'll Do
 

🗝️ Key Focus Areas: 

  • Donor & Fundraising Support – 30% 
  • Volunteer Program Management – 30% 
  • Event Coordination – 20% 
  • Marketing & Communications – 20%

 

☎️ Donor & Fundraising Support 

  • Support donor stewardship and cultivation efforts by preparing personalized thank‑you letters, coordinating follow‑up communications, and ensuring timely and accurate gift processing and data entry. 
  • Assist in the planning and execution of fundraising initiatives, including annual campaigns, Giving Day activities, and targeted donor appeals. 
  • Maintain accurate and up‑to‑date donor information in the CRM system, ensuring data integrity and generating regular donor, gift, and activity reports for internal stakeholders. 
  • Track donor pipeline activity and sponsorship commitments, helping to monitor progress toward fundraising goals and identifying opportunities for engagement and cultivation. 
  • Assist the Director of Advancement in preparing donor briefings, follow-up tasks, and stewardship actions to ensure consistent engagement and relationship management 
  • Attend WOW events and serve as an ambassador for our mission when engaging with the public 

 

 Volunteer Program Management 

  • Oversee the volunteer program end‑to‑end, including intake, scheduling, communication, and ongoing engagement. 
  • Manage volunteer requests and coordinate assignments, ensuring alignment with departmental service needs and organizational priorities. 
  • Communicate timely reminders, updates, and recognition messages to ensure volunteers are informed, supported, and acknowledged for their service. 
  • Track and confirm completion of volunteer hours, maintaining accurate documentation and reporting for internal use. 
  • Collaborate with WOW departments to identify service needs, plan volunteer opportunities, and ensure staffing coverage for events and programs. 
     

 📢 Event Coordination 

  • Support logistics for special events, including donor gatherings, community outreach activities, and signature WOW events. 
  • Support event operations, such as guest lists, invitations, RSVP tracking, on‑site setup, and post‑event breakdown. 
  • Assist with sponsorship fulfillment, including collecting, organizing, and coordinating materials for donor recognition. 

 
📊 Marketing & Communications 

  • Contribute to the development of content for newsletters, website, and social media 
  • Create simple graphics and digital assets to promote WOW stories and events 
  • Assist with photo and video content collection, including capturing program highlights 
  • Help ensure brand consistency across all outreach materials 
  • Help maintain outreach lists and coordinate email communications 
  • Prepare resources and materials for community presentations and tours
